The Cardinals reported to training camp on Tuesday with a different vibe from a year ago. Coach Jonathan Gannon enters his second year guiding the Big Red, this time with his starting quarterback ready to go. Kyler Murray is expected to hit the ground running after spending much of 2023 rehabbing his injured knee. Craig Grialou, Paul Calvisi and Rob Fredrickson project what the offense might do with a healthy Murray. Plus, discussions about the rookie class potentially contributing right away and how the defense might perform after upgrading the line through free agency and the draft.
